导言
近期若干用户反馈 TPWallet 出现“提错”或提现失败的情况。本文从便捷资金提现、合约兼容、专家解读、智能商业生态、身份验证与安全补丁六个维度做出全方位分析,旨在帮助用户、产品和安全团队定位问题、评估风险并推进修复与长期防范策略。

一、便捷资金提现:问题表现与影响面
常见表现包括提现延迟、失败返回错误码、资产未到账但链上交易存在或相反。影响面:用户信任下降、流动性受阻、客服压力上升。关键要点为:明确失败场景(前端校验、签名失败、nonce/nonce冲突、跨链桥中继失败或目标合约拒绝交易)、保留完整日志(txHash、错误码、节点响应)并提供给用户可查追踪链路。
二、合约兼容性:根源分析与兼容策略
TPWallet 常需与多种链上合约交互(ERC-20/721/1155、跨链桥合约、聚合器)。兼容性问题多因合约函数签名差异、代币不合规实现(如非标准返回值)、重入保护或 gas 限制导致失败。建议:实现通用适配层(ABI 动态解析与回退策略)、交易预估与模拟(eth_call 模拟执行)、增加对非标准代币的兼容适配器并对跨链桥进行多节点验证和可靠性评分。
三、专家解读:治理与运营建议
安全专家建议两条主线并行:一是短期应急(回滚或热修、用户提示与赔偿机制、黑名单与临时风控);二是中长期改进(改进测试流水线、完善合约交互规范、建立多签热备与责任制)。同时需与链上审计方和生态合作方通报,形成联合通告以稳定用户预期。
四、智能商业生态:对钱包生态的影响与机会

问题暴露也提示钱包需构建更智能的商业生态:包括交易聚合(自动选择可靠路由)、风控市场(对第三方合约打分),以及通过插件或轻量中间件实现扩展兼容。良性生态能将单点失败影响降到最低,并为用户提供替代通道和透明度(例如交易模拟结果、失败原因可视化)。
五、安全身份验证:保护资金与减少误操作
许多提现问题源于签名或身份认证流程异常。建议采用多层身份验证:设备绑定+生物/指纹认证(本地安全芯片保护私钥)、阈值签名(MPC或多签用于大额交易)、行为风控(异常路径检测)。同时所有更改敏感配置的操作应触发二次确认与链上可追溯日志。
六、安全补丁与发布流程:从修复到闭环
补丁发布应遵循:1) 问题复现与范围界定;2) 编写最小可行修复(hotfix)并在测试网验证;3) 回归测试与外部安全审计(必要时白帽赏金);4) 分阶段灰度发布并监控指标(失败率、用户投诉);5) 发布公告与回滚方案。补丁同时应包含监控埋点与熔断器(当异常率升高时自动限制高风险操作)。
附:用户与开发者的具体建议
对用户:在官方确认修复前避免进行高额提现,保留交易凭证,开启多重验证并关注官方渠道公告。对开发/运维:增强模拟测试覆盖(包括非标准代币),完善 CI/CD 中的链上集成测试,部署自动化回滚与补丁响应流程,并建立专门的安全运营(SecOps)小组。
结语
TPWallet 的提现类报错是一个系统性问题的表征,既有技术兼容、合约多样性带来的挑战,也暴露了流程、监控与治理的缺口。通过短期应急与长期架构改进并举,结合更智能的生态与严格的身份与补丁管理,可降低类似事件的发生概率并提高用户信任。
评论
AlexChen
文章很全面,尤其是合约兼容与模拟执行那部分,对钱包开发者很有启发。
小白
收到提现失败提醒好烦,照着本文的用户建议操作,先不动大额提现,等官方通知。
CryptoFan99
建议加入更多跨链桥具体案例分析,但总体看法很务实,安全流程必须建立起来。
链上听风
MPC 与多签对大额资金管理确实重要,期待钱包厂商加速落地这些方案。
Maya
补丁发布流程写得很清晰,希望团队能把热修与灰度实践化,降低用户影响。